How to Call Poland from the UK: A Guide for SMBs and Startups
The country code for Poland is +48. You’ll need to include this code when dialing any Polish number from outside the country, including from the UK. It tells the phone system to route your call to Poland.
For example: If you’re calling a mobile number in Poland, it will start with +48, followed by the rest of the number, minus the leading zero.

On most smartphones, pressing and holding the “0” key brings up the “+” symbol. This acts as a substitute for the international exit code. You can dial +48 instead of 00-48 for quicker calling.
Here are a few popular area codes in Poland that UK businesses commonly call:
Area Code | Location |
---|---|
12 | Kraków |
22 | Warsaw |
32 | Katowice |
42 | Łódź |
58 | Gdańsk |
61 | Poznań |
71 | Wrocław |
81 | Lublin |
85 | Białystok |
91 | Szczecin |
89 | Olsztyn |
17 | Rzeszów |
52 | Bydgoszcz |
95 | Gorzów Wielkopolski |
33 | Bielsko-Biała |
Use these codes after the country code (+48) to ensure your call is routed to the correct region in Poland.

Poland’s international country code is 48. Local area codes vary by city or region (e.g., 22 for Warsaw, 12 for Kraków).
Yes, when calling from the UK to Poland, you must include the +48 country code, even for mobile numbers.
Start with the + sign, followed by the country code (48 for Poland), and then the full number (skipping any leading 0).
A country code replaces the domestic dialing prefix (like 0) used within the country. For example, Polish numbers starting with 0 must drop the 0 when dialed internationally.
